REVIEW:

Volume three of this series covering Mick Taylor 1990 European tour presents the Munich show re cording of which all versions were coming from a video rip, but with defaults. All tracks have been edited, deleting lots of little defaults/gaps coming from the video recordings and the treble frequencies have been decreased using a slight filter. The overall length was around 80 minutes, so t was decided to separate the whole into two discs. Both Laundromat Blues and Can’t You Hear Me Knocking have fade ins. This recording is on the verge of being saturated, so much so that it cannot be enjoyed in full.

As bonus have been added two extracts of a Mick Taylor interview for the German TV channel Tele 5 for a show called Yesterday, which came from Munich. Only the parts with the extracts from Munich’s show were kept. In particular on Leather Jacket is shown the work of Max Middleton better than on the video recording rip.
